Regulatory Compliance Burdens
The residential switchgear market faces significant challenges due to stringent regulatory compliance requirements. These regulations, often set forth by entities such as the International Electrotechnical Commission (IEC) and national safety boards, impose rigorous testing and certification processes that can delay product development and increase operational costs. For instance, compliance with the IEC 61439 standard requires manufacturers to ensure that their switchgear meets specific safety and performance criteria, which can deter innovation and lead to hesitance among consumers who are wary of potential failures. As a result, established companies may find themselves constrained by the need to invest heavily in compliance measures, while new entrants struggle to navigate the complex regulatory landscape, limiting their ability to compete effectively.

Asia Pacific Market Statistics:
Asia Pacific represented more than 41.2% of the global residential switchgear market in 2025, positioning it as the largest and fastest-growing region. The robust demand for residential switchgear is primarily driven by high residential construction activities in key markets such as China and India. These countries are undergoing significant urbanization and infrastructure development, which are crucial for modernizing electrical systems. The increasing emphasis on sustainability and energy efficiency is further catalyzing investments in advanced switchgear technologies. Notably, the International Energy Agency (IEA) reports that the region's commitment to enhancing energy security and reducing carbon footprints is reshaping consumer preferences towards smart and efficient electrical solutions. As a result, Asia Pacific presents substantial opportunities for stakeholders in the residential switchgear market, driven by evolving consumer needs and technological advancements.

Japan also plays a crucial role in the Asia Pacific residential switchgear market, driven by a commitment to technological innovation and energy efficiency. The country’s focus on disaster resilience, particularly following events like the 2011 earthquake and tsunami, has led to a heightened demand for reliable and advanced switchgear systems. The Ministry of the Environment in Japan advocates for the adoption of energy-efficient technologies, which aligns with consumer preferences for safety and sustainability. Companies like Mitsubishi Electric are at the forefront, developing cutting-edge solutions that cater to these needs. This strategic alignment of regulatory frameworks and consumer expectations positions Japan as a key player in the regional market, reinforcing Asia Pacific's leadership in the residential switchgear sector and presenting significant opportunities for growth.

Analysis by Installation
The residential switchgear market in the installation segment is led by indoor switchgear, which captured a commanding 68.6% share in 2025. This dominance is primarily attributed to the space-efficient designs that cater to the increasing demand for compact electrical solutions in modern homes. As urban living trends continue to rise, customer preferences lean towards products that maximize utility while minimizing footprint, thereby enhancing the appeal of indoor switchgear. Companies like Schneider Electric have emphasized the importance of compact designs in their product offerings, aligning with sustainability priorities and energy efficiency. This segment presents strategic advantages for both established firms and emerging players, as the growing focus on smart home technologies creates opportunities for innovation. Given the ongoing developments in urban infrastructure and residential design, the indoor installation segment is expected to maintain its relevance in the near to medium term.

Analysis by Voltage
The residential switchgear market's voltage segment is dominated by low voltage switchgear, which held a significant 73.5% share in 2025. This segment's leadership is largely driven by stringent residential safety standards that prioritize low voltage solutions for enhanced protection against electrical hazards. The increasing awareness of safety and compliance among homeowners has led to a growing demand for low voltage systems, which are often recommended by regulatory bodies such as the National Fire Protection Association (NFPA). This segment not only provides established firms with a solid foundation for growth but also opens doors for emerging players focused on innovative safety solutions. As regulatory frameworks evolve and consumer awareness around safety continues to rise, the low voltage switchgear segment is expected to maintain its critical role in the residential market.

In 2026, the market for residential switchgear is valued at USD 22.44 billion.
Residential Switchgear Market size is likely to expand from USD 21.04 billion in 2025 to USD 43.77 billion by 2035, posting a CAGR above 7.6% across 2026-2035.
In 2025, indoor segment captured 68.6% residential switchgear market share, propelled by indoor switchgear dominates due to space-efficient designs.
Holding 77.6% share in 2025, the success of AC segment was shaped by AC switchgear leads due to standard residential power systems.
The market share of low segment stood at 73.5% in 2025, propelled by low voltage switchgear dominates due to residential safety standards.
Asia Pacific region dominated over 41.2% market share in 2025, impelled by high residential construction in China and India.
Asia Pacific region will grow at more than 8.4% CAGR between 2026 and 2035, propelled by urbanization and electrification in asia.
Top companies in the residential switchgear market comprise ABB (Switzerland), Siemens (Germany), Schneider Electric (France), Eaton (Ireland), GE (USA), Mitsubishi Electric (Japan), Legrand (France), Chint Group (China), Toshiba (Japan), Havells (India).
